What is personal training?

A personal trainer creates bespoke fitness programmes to help support your treatment plan and meet your overall treatment goals. This includes motivating and guiding you to incorporate physical activity into your routine and meet fitness goals that will restore physical health. While improving your fitness is not your primary reason for coming to Paracelsus Recovery, physical training is a key part of our recovery programmes. Our integrated and holistic approach to treatment appreciates the mind-body connection and the significant impact exercise has on both physical and psychological well-being. Including personal training in your treatment plan recognises exercise as a transformative tool in the realm of mental health recovery. 

By getting our clients to move their bodies and do some exercises, our personal trainers help them to feel better both physically and mentally. Through introducing them to ways in which the body and mind affect one another, our personal trainers provide our clients with empowering tools to restore and optimise their health and wellness. The work they do together enables clients to build strong foundations, both physical and mental, for long-lasting recovery. Therefore, working with a personal trainer is an ideal complement to the main treatments clients have with doctors and therapists.

What are the benefits of having a personal trainer?

A main benefit is that personal training is the opportunity it provides for clients to have a break from more mentally and emotionally demanding therapies with doctors, psychiatrists and therapists. So while the training process helps them feel better physically and mentally, it also offers “down-time” from the core therapies in a certain sense. In addition, when participating in personal training, there are the obvious physical restoration benefits such as better flexibility, strength and endurance. Exercise can also improve bone density, sleep and energy levels and help with weight management. 

However, the benefits of exercise extend far beyond optimising physical health. The impact on mental and emotional health can be profound. For example, the endorphins released during exercise can enhance mood and alleviate feelings of depression and anxiety. Exercise also relieves stress and boosts self-esteem and confidence. Crucially, working with a personal trainer offers a chance to interact socially, which is a critical component of mental health recovery. As is the structure that incorporating exercise into a daily routine creates. For all the above reasons, including structured, expert-guided and tailored exercise in mental health or substance abuse recovery programmes is essential and hugely beneficial.
